Starting with Pickup and Transportation

The adventure begins with a pickup in Puerto Escondido, where a driver transports you comfortably for about 30 minutes to the riding location. This early transfer is a practical aspect to keep the group organized and to ensure everyone is ready for the ride. The pickup service is included, which adds to the overall value of the experience, especially for those staying in accommodations somewhat outside the main town.

The Horseback Ride: Trails, Rivers, and Agriculture

Once at the starting point, you’ll be assigned a trained and experienced horse suited to your riding comfort level. This is a thoughtful touch, as it ensures safety and a smoother ride, especially for those new to horseback riding. The ride itself lasts roughly three hours, taking you along scenic trails and across rivers that feed into the nearby lagoon of Manialtepec.

The guides are praised for their local knowledge, often sharing interesting insights into the region’s agriculture and rural life. This makes the ride more than just a scenic trek; it becomes a mini-lesson on the area’s farming practices and natural environment. Expect to see fields of crops, perhaps sugar cane or other local produce, and learn about how the countryside sustains the local economy.

The crossing of rivers is a highlight for many: a refreshing splash and a chance to feel connected to the landscape. The rivers are gentle but add an element of adventure, especially in the context of the lush surroundings. Many reviews mention the stunning scenery along the trails, with lush greenery and peaceful water scenes that are perfect for photos.

Reaching Virgen Beach and the Small Restaurant

After about three hours of riding, you’ll arrive at a secluded, virgin beach called Puerto Suelo. This spot offers an unmatched sense of privacy, away from crowded tourist beaches. Here, you can relax, take in the breathtaking sunset, and enjoy the tranquility of this untouched shoreline.

The tour includes a short stop at a local restaurant, where both horses and riders can rest. Here, there’s an opportunity to purchase small snacks or drinks—perfect for a quick refreshment before heading back. The Return and Reflection

After sunset, the group mounts their horses again for the return journey, retracing a different scenic route back to the starting point. The entire experience lasts about four and a half hours, with transportation included both ways. This length allows for a relaxed pace, giving you ample time to enjoy the scenery and take photographs.

What to Bring

Travelers should prepare for the outdoor nature of the tour by bringing a sun hat, sunscreen, biodegradable insect repellent, and comfortable, breathable clothing. Since the tour includes crossing rivers, quick-drying clothes might be helpful, especially if you’re prone to splashes.

Age and Physical Fitness

The tour isn’t suitable for people over 70, likely due to the physical demands of horseback riding and uneven terrain. Moderate physical fitness is recommended, but the relaxed pace and professional guides make it accessible for most healthy adults.

Food and Drinks

While no food or alcohol are included, the onsite restaurant offers small snacks and drinks for purchase. It’s a good idea to bring a water bottle and perhaps some snacks for extra energy.
